Facilities specializing in the repair and restoration of cylinder heads are vital to the automotive industry. These businesses utilize specialized equipment like milling machines, boring bars, and valve grinders to resurface, rebuild, and ensure the proper function of these critical engine components. A typical service might involve repairing a cracked head, replacing worn valve guides, or performing a complete valve job. 3. Equipment/Technology

The efficacy of a cylinder head machine shop directly correlates with the precision and sophistication of its equipment. Modern machinery allows for highly accurate measurements and machining operations, crucial for restoring critical cylinder head dimensions and ensuring optimal engine performance. Specialized equipment like coordinate measuring machines (CMMs) enables precise three-dimensional measurements of the cylinder head, identifying minute deviations from factory specifications. These measurements inform subsequent machining processes, ensuring accurate resurfacing, valve guide replacement, and other critical repairs. For example, a warped cylinder head requires precise milling to restore flatness; without advanced milling machines capable of micron-level precision, the repair might compromise the head gasket seal and engine performance.

Technological advancements in machining processes further enhance the capabilities of these shops. Computer Numerical Control (CNC) machining centers automate complex operations, ensuring repeatable accuracy and reducing human error. CNC machining allows for intricate porting and polishing work, optimizing airflow for improved engine performance. Furthermore, advanced welding techniques, such as Tungsten Inert Gas (TIG) welding, enable precise repairs to cracked or damaged cylinder heads. For instance, a cracked exhaust port can be repaired with TIG welding, restoring structural integrity without compromising the intricate geometry of the port. These technological advancements contribute significantly to the quality and durability of cylinder head repairs.

Frequently Asked Questions

This section addresses common inquiries regarding cylinder head machining and repair services, providing concise and informative responses to facilitate informed decision-making.

Question 1: What are the common signs of a damaged cylinder head?

Common indicators include coolant leaks, overheating, loss of engine power, white exhaust smoke, and engine misfires. A professional diagnosis is crucial to determine the specific issue and appropriate course of action.

Question 2: How often should a cylinder head be serviced?

Preventative maintenance schedules vary depending on engine type and operating conditions. Consulting the vehicle manufacturer’s recommendations provides guidance on appropriate service intervals for specific applications. Regular inspections by qualified technicians can identify potential issues early and prevent catastrophic failures.

Question 3: What is the difference between resurfacing and rebuilding a cylinder head?

Resurfacing involves machining the mating surface of the cylinder head to restore flatness, typically addressing minor warping or imperfections. Rebuilding involves a complete disassembly and inspection of the cylinder head, replacing worn components such as valves, valve guides, and springs. The chosen service depends on the extent of damage and specific engine requirements.

Question 4: Can a cracked cylinder head be repaired?

Depending on the severity and location of the crack, repair might be possible through specialized welding techniques. A qualified technician assesses the feasibility of repair based on factors like crack size, location, and material composition. In some cases, replacement might be the more cost-effective and reliable solution.

Question 5: How long does a typical cylinder head repair take?

Turnaround time varies significantly based on the complexity of the repair, parts availability, and shop workload. Simple repairs like resurfacing might take a few days, while complex rebuilds could require several weeks. Consulting with the chosen shop provides a more accurate estimate based on specific project requirements.
